Threads platform unveils enhanced transparency and feature upgrades

Friday, May 9, 2025, 6:20 am

Meta rolls out significant updates on its Threads platform as the social network debuts both a new dashboard to clarify account restrictions with added transparency and fresh feature enhancements, including video ad integration. These changes aim to improve user understanding of enforcement measures while strengthening Threads’ competitive edge in the evolving digital arena.

Meta has enhanced its Threads platform with a new "Account Status" feature, providing users with crucial transparency on post removals, content demotions, and other account penalties, including a direct appeals process. Apple Shifts iPhone Production to Brazil to Dodge U.S. Tariffs

Facing escalating U.S. tariffs, Apple appears to be quietly shifting iPhone production to Brazil through its Foxconn partnership. Despite Apple’s denials, industry insiders suggest this strategic relocation aims to stabilize prices and secure the supply chain, proving that when it comes to international trade, geography often trumps rhetoric. Apple Advances Smart Glasses Project With Custom Chip Innovation

Reports indicate that Apple is developing bespoke chip designs intended specifically for its upcoming smart glasses. The new processor—evolved from the Apple Watch’s low-power chips—aims to boost both power efficiency and performance, pushing the tech giant further into the augmented reality space. More...

Google Gemini API introduces caching to slash developer costs

Google is shaking up the developer playground by adding an implicit caching feature to its Gemini 2.5 API, promising to cut costs by up to 75%. By reusing common data prefixes, this move transforms repetitive prompt handling, making high-powered AI more efficient—and a bit more wallet‐friendly—for tech innovators. More...
